MB A 000 542 06 87 (Mercedes, Smart)

EPC / Mercedes / MB A 000 542 06 87
FRAME
MB A 000 542 06 87 | MB A0005420687 | MB 0005420687
Part Price Price Availability Seller
FRAME
VAG A 000 542 06 87 Get price in stock
Get price
in stock
PARTSinn